thin

    0熱度

    1回答

    我有Rails和瘦服務器的問題。出於某種原因,Thin清除了ARGV變量(我甚至不問爲什麼:/),並且我的Rails應用程序需要確定Thin是否作爲守護程序服務器運行。我嘗試訪問/查找應用程序和機架變量中的服務器對象,但沒有運氣。如果有任何方法來訪問Thin實例選項,甚至是原始ARGV,那麼我可以解析它並確定Thin是否作爲守護進程運行?

    0熱度

    1回答

    太差勁: $ thin restart -p 4000 -s 3 -d; Stopping server on 0.0.0.0:4000 ... Sending QUIT signal to process 13375 ... >> Exiting! Stopping server on 0.0.0.0:4001 ... Sending QUIT signal to process 13

    7熱度

    4回答

    我可以用細跟 bundle exec thin start --ssl --ssl-verify --ssl-key-file /private/etc/apache2/ssl/server.key --ssl-cert-file /private/etc/apache2/ssl/server.crt 它可以在控制檯/終端,完美 但是,當我嘗試添加在「運行/調試配置」中的RubyMine這些選

    12熱度

    2回答

    我正試圖在Cedar堆棧上部署Sinatra流式SSE響應應用程序。不幸的是,雖然它在開發過程中完美工作,但一旦部署到Heroku,當連接被調用時,callback或errback永遠不會被調用,從而導致連接池充滿陳舊的連接(永遠不會超時,因爲數據仍然被髮送給它們服務器端)從Heroku的文檔 Relvant信息: 長輪詢和流媒體的反應 雪松支持HTTP 1.1的功能,如長輪詢和流媒體的反應。一個

    0熱度

    1回答

    是否有一個函數可以讓我精簡數據(時間序列爲動物園)? 的例子是 mytime<-as.POSIXct(paste("2013-07-09 12:", c(1:59), sep="")) mydata<-EuStockMarkets[1:59] myts<-zoo(mydata, mytime) 我搜索返回只有這些數據的時間序列不規則,這是以前的時間步長通過讓說,十個點不同的功能。 動物園的

    1熱度

    2回答

    我對我的Sinatra應用程序做了簡單的測試,當我調用長處理程序時,虛擬請求被阻止。 bundle exec rackup -s thin 據Is Sinatra multi threaded?,薄應該是一個多線程Web服務器: get '/test/long' do sleep 10 "finished" end get '/test/dummy' do

    1熱度

    1回答

    我在Centos 6上運行Shopify控制面板(http://shopify.github.io/dashing/)。我希望在啓動時通過cron啓動,當我從git下載更新時。 我在bash腳本中有以下代碼,它與我通過命令行運行以啓動儀表板的代碼相同。 #!/bin/bash cd /usr/share/dashboard/ dashing start -p 500 -d 運行實際腳本作爲從命令行

    1熱度

    1回答

    我在測試Rails應用程序時遇到了以下問題。 使用EventMachine進行異步HTTP請求時,出於某種原因,我無法在回調中使用ActiveRecord對象。 每當我嘗試訪問我得到下面的異常對象:如果我從回調刪除ActiveRecord對象 /home/user/.rvm/gems/ruby-1.8.7-p371/gems/activerecord-2.3.18/lib/active_recor

    1熱度

    1回答

    這個問題的主題是我最好的猜測罪魁禍首,但我不知道我相信它。總之,我的問題是:我的Sinatra應用程序出了什麼問題? 這裏的設置: 我在路線之一有post '/attachments/go' do …。 我有自己的看法下列操作之一: <form action="/attachments/go" enctype="multipart/form-data" method="post"> <i

    3熱度

    1回答

    我使用Nginx Web服務器和5個精簡應用服務器在Ubuntu上運行Rails。 每天一次系統變得非常緩慢,有時會掛起。 我不知道,如果它的瘦服務器,但是當我停止服務器時,它的掛,我得到: Can't stop process, no PID found in tmp/pids/thin.3000.pid 下面是該瘦的啓動和停止日誌: [email protected]:/opt/bitna